Solitude On The Rocks:When Quiet Meets Chaos
Max Thompson has perfected the art of solitude. His nights consist of the simple joys that bring him peace: video games, a glass of wine, and pad thai (always with peanuts). Life in his small Chicago apartment suits him just fine, far away from the chaos of the world and the demands of other people.
But Max’s carefully curated quiet life is thrown into disarray when the apartment board, a meddlesome trio of self-appointed authority, shows up at his door. Their mission? To solve a bizarre mystery involving an abandoned frying pan near the recycling room. What begins as a trivial matter spirals into an uproarious and absurd saga, dragging Max unwillingly into the lives of his neighbors.
As the board’s relentless pursuit of the culprit disrupts the building’s fragile harmony, Max finds himself drawn into unexpected conversations, awkward encounters, and even moments of connection he never thought he’d welcome. From sharing snacks with Sarah, a kind but persistent neighbor, to navigating the quirky dynamics of his apartment community, Max slowly realizes that solitude isn’t the only path to happiness.
Set against the backdrop of urban apartment life, *The Quiet After the Storm* is a witty, heartwarming exploration of one man’s journey to find balance between isolation and connection. With sharp humor, endearing characters, and relatable moments, this story captures the universal struggle of maintaining boundaries while embracing the beauty of shared spaces.
